(Tuesday, June 11, 1776; during the American Revolutionary War and the American Revolution) — The Continental Congress formed the Committee of Five today to draft a Declaration of Independence calling for freedom from Britain.

The committee was composed of John Adams, Benjamin Franklin, Thomas Jefferson, Robert Livingston, and Roger Sherman.
